About Schools in Vernon, Utah
Vernon, Utah is home to 1 schools, including 1 public school. The city's schools span 1 elementary school.
Vernon is served by 1 school district: Tooele District. These districts collectively serve 16,087 students.
Vernon's community shows 16% bachelor's degree attainment with a median household income of $78,550. The poverty rate in the area is 11.4%.

Community Profile
Vernon has a median household income of $78,550. It is a community where 16%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$275,000, with a median rent of $917/month. The area has a poverty rate of 11.4%.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
